blob: 3765ef095164ce1f39b74e31be943d61f326012c [file] [log] [blame]
# Copyright 2020 The Chromium Authors. All rights reserved.
# Use of this source code is governed by a BSD-style license that can be
# found in the LICENSE file.
import("//chrome/browser/resources/settings/settings.gni")
import("//ui/webui/resources/tools/js_modulizer.gni")
import("../namespace_rewrites.gni")
js_modulizer("modulize") {
input_files = [
"about_page_tests.js",
"all_sites_tests.js",
"appearance_fonts_page_test.js",
"appearance_page_test.js",
"autofill_page_test.js",
"autofill_section_test.js",
"basic_page_test.js",
"category_default_setting_tests.js",
"category_setting_exceptions_tests.js",
"checkbox_tests.js",
"chooser_exception_list_entry_tests.js",
"chooser_exception_list_tests.js",
"clear_browsing_data_test.js",
"controlled_button_tests.js",
"controlled_radio_button_tests.js",
"downloads_page_test.js",
"dropdown_menu_tests.js",
"edit_dictionary_page_test.js",
"extension_controlled_indicator_tests.js",
"fake_input_method_private.js",
"fake_language_settings_private.js",
"fake_settings_private.js",
"idle_load_tests.js",
"languages_page_tests.js",
"languages_tests.js",
"on_startup_page_tests.js",
"passwords_and_autofill_fake_data.js",
"passwords_export_test.js",
"password_check_test.js",
"passwords_section_test.js",
"payments_section_test.js",
"people_page_test.js",
"people_page_sync_controls_test.js",
"people_page_sync_page_test.js",
"people_page_sync_page_interactive_test.js",
"personalization_options_test.js",
"prefs_test_cases.js",
"prefs_tests.js",
"pref_util_tests.js",
"protocol_handlers_tests.js",
"recent_site_permissions_test.js",
"reset_page_test.js",
"search_engines_page_test.js",
"search_page_test.js",
"search_settings_test.js",
"security_keys_subpage_test.js",
"settings_animated_pages_test.js",
"settings_main_test.js",
"settings_menu_test.js",
"settings_slider_tests.js",
"settings_subpage_test.js",
"settings_textarea_tests.js",
"settings_toggle_button_tests.js",
"settings_ui_tests.js",
"site_data_test.js",
"site_data_details_subpage_tests.js",
"site_details_tests.js",
"site_details_permission_tests.js",
"site_entry_tests.js",
"site_list_entry_tests.js",
"site_list_tests.js",
"site_favicon_test.js",
"site_settings_page_test.js",
"startup_urls_page_test.js",
"sync_test_util.js",
"test_about_page_browser_proxy.js",
"test_extension_control_browser_proxy.js",
"test_languages_browser_proxy.js",
"test_lifetime_browser_proxy.js",
"test_local_data_browser_proxy.js",
"test_metrics_browser_proxy.js",
"test_open_window_proxy.js",
"test_password_manager_proxy.js",
"test_privacy_page_browser_proxy.js",
"test_profile_info_browser_proxy.js",
"test_reset_browser_proxy.js",
"test_search_engines_browser_proxy.js",
"test_site_settings_prefs_browser_proxy.js",
"test_sync_browser_proxy.js",
"test_util.js",
]
if (is_win) {
input_files += [
"chrome_cleanup_page_test.js",
"incompatible_applications_page_test.js",
]
}
if (is_chromeos) {
input_files += [
"passwords_section_test_cros.js",
"site_list_tests_cros.js",
"people_page_test_cros.js",
"test_android_info_browser_proxy.js",
]
} else {
input_files += [
"default_browser_browsertest.js",
"import_data_dialog_test.js",
"people_page_manage_profile_test.js",
"system_page_tests.js",
]
}
namespace_rewrites = settings_namespace_rewrites + test_namespace_rewrites + [
"android_info.TestAndroidInfoBrowserProxy|TestAndroidInfoBrowserProxy",
"android_info.TEST_ANDROID_SMS_ORIGIN|TEST_ANDROID_SMS_ORIGIN",
"autofill_test_util.PasswordSectionElementFactory|PasswordSectionElementFactory",
"autofill_test_util.PasswordManagerExpectations|PasswordManagerExpectations",
"autofill_test_util.AutofillManagerExpectations|AutofillManagerExpectations",
"autofill_test_util.PaymentsManagerExpectations|PaymentsManagerExpectations",
"autofill_test_util.TestAutofillManager|TestAutofillManager",
"autofill_test_util.TestPaymentsManager|TestPaymentsManager",
"autofill_test_util.create|create",
"autofill_test_util.makeCompromisedCredential|makeCompromisedCredential",
"autofill_test_util.makePasswordCheckStatus|makePasswordCheckStatus",
"export_passwords_tests.run|run",
"reset_page.TestResetBrowserProxy|TestResetBrowserProxy",
"settings.CHROME_CLEANUP_DEFAULT_ITEMS_TO_SHOW|CHROME_CLEANUP_DEFAULT_ITEMS_TO_SHOW",
"settings.ChromeCleanupIdleReason|ChromeCleanupIdleReason",
"settings.defaultSettingLabel|defaultSettingLabel",
"settings.FakeLanguageSettingsPrivate|FakeLanguageSettingsPrivate",
"settings.FakeInputMethodPrivate|FakeInputMethodPrivate",
"settings.FakeSettingsPrivate|FakeSettingsPrivate",
"settings.getFakeLanguagePrefs|getFakeLanguagePrefs",
"settings.kMenuCloseDelay|kMenuCloseDelay",
"settings.setLanguageSettingsPrivateApiForTest|setLanguageSettingsPrivateApiForTest",
"settings.setSearchManagerForTesting|setSearchManagerForTesting",
"settings.TestLanguagesBrowserProxy|TestLanguagesBrowserProxy",
"settings.TestLifetimeBrowserProxy|TestLifetimeBrowserProxy",
"settings_search.createSampleSearchEngine|createSampleSearchEngine",
"settings_search.TestSearchEnginesBrowserProxy|TestSearchEnginesBrowserProxy",
"sync_test_util.getSyncAllPrefs|getSyncAllPrefs",
"sync_test_util.setupRouterWithSyncRoutes|setupRouterWithSyncRoutes",
"sync_test_util.simulateSyncStatus|simulateSyncStatus",
"sync_test_util.simulateStoredAccounts|simulateStoredAccounts",
"test_util.createContentSettingTypeToValuePair|createContentSettingTypeToValuePair",
"test_util.createDefaultContentSetting|createDefaultContentSetting",
"test_util.createOriginInfo|createOriginInfo",
"test_util.createRawChooserException|createRawChooserException",
"test_util.createRawSiteException|createRawSiteException",
"test_util.createSiteGroup|createSiteGroup",
"test_util.createSiteSettingsPrefs|createSiteSettingsPrefs",
"test_util.getContentSettingsTypeFromChooserType|getContentSettingsTypeFromChooserType",
"test_util.setupPopstateListener|setupPopstateListener",
]
}